Anyone have a list of HD stations?
I had a site bookmarked (etown) that had a list of all the HD stations for each state. They also had a weekly list of all the HD shows on network & HBO & Showtime HD. But the site disappeared 2 months ago. I just got a rotor put on my antenna and want to see if I can get NBC or PBS's HD station, but I have no idea what channel number to try to tune in. I live in the Philadelphia area. Fox is 42-1, ABC is 64-1, and CBS is 26-3. Anyone know where I could find out what the other station numbers are?

I work for a PBS station that is broadcasting digital. We have channel info on our website for our digital station, but I just saw that few other stations do that.
I dug through my links at the FCC, and found a file of the assigned numbers for DTV stations:
http://www.fcc.gov/oet/dtv/start/dtv2-69.txt
It's older, but last I heard not very many stations have changed their digital numbers yet.
